Blackberry Wine by Joanne Harris explores the journey of a writer named Jay, who returns to a French village. He reflects on his past, particularly influenced by a mysterious friend, Joe. The narrative intertwines memory, magic, and the art of creation, as Jay confronts life choices and his own inspirations.

Blackberry Wine by Joanne Harris enchants readers with its vivid prose and magical realism. The narrative weaves past and present through rich storytelling and complex characters. Positively noted for its atmosphere and creativity, some critics find the plot lacks depth in places. Overall, a charming exploration of memory and self-discovery.
Readers who enjoy Blackberry Wine by Joanne Harris are typically drawn to magical realism, nostalgia, and explorations of memory. They may appreciate the charm found in works like Chocolat by Harris or Garcia Marquez's One Hundred Years of Solitude, where the past influences the present in enchanting ways.
